Microsoft Unveils Customizable Taskbars and Enhanced Security in Latest Windows 11 Updates
Microsoft has released two cumulative updates for Windows 11 - KB5122880 and KB5124008. The updates bring various changes, additions, and improvements to Windows 11, including hundreds of security fixes.
The non-security related changes include the ability to move the Taskbar from the bottom of the screen and change its size. Users can now choose whether the taskbar appears at the bottom, top, left, or right side of their screen. In addition, a smaller taskbar option is available to help maximize screen space on smaller devices.
The updates also improve the reliability of loading the system tray area of the Taskbar for non-touch PCs and add new Start menu sizing options. The 'Recommended' section in the Start menu has been renamed to 'Recent', and users can now hide their name and profile picture in the Start menu.
